It appears as if all the rumors suggesting Star Wars: The Rise of Skywalker may be a complete disaster may be true as a new clip offers absolutely no hope for the final film in the Skywalker saga.

Similar to those cringe-inducing Poe jokes at the beginning of Rian Johnson’s awful The Last Jedi, we see that J.J. Abrams is not going to fix Star Wars as a new clip recently released offers perhaps an even cringier line with: “They fly now.”

I’m guessing Disney was hoping that #TheyFlyNow would go viral and help promote the movie, but just the opposite has happened, as it’s simply awful.

Fans on social media have even pointed out that Poe being clueless, as well as Finn, about the fact that Stormtroopers can fly, makes zero sense – just like all of the Disney Star Wars movies – because, in the comics, Poe has seen the Stormtroopers fly before, not to mention Finn was a Stormtrooper.

So we see J.J. Abrams and those that worked on Star Wars: The Rise of Skywalker didn’t bother doing their homework, and similar to Rian Johnson, just didn’t care.
